Test plan: migrating nightly cron jobs from the Pelmar scheduler host to the Quillway workflow engine. Phase one covers the three report-generation jobs only; each will run in shadow mode for a week while we diff outputs against the legacy runs. Please verify the retry semantics match, since Quillway defaults to exponential backoff. To exercise the staging trigger endpoint during review, authenticate with the token below.

session JWT of yawep-yawep = eyJhbGciOiJIUzI1NiIsInR5cCI6IkpXVCJ9.eyJzdWIiOiI3pWF3_In0.aXYsHiog

Security-relevant faults: unit-conversion overflow (possible DoS via crafted fraction inputs) and the ingredient-parser regex, which has a known catastrophic-backtracking case. Both are rate-limited at the gateway; confirm limits are active before escalating. Sev1: parser CPU pegged >5 min across two nodes. Sev2: single-node overflow crash. Page the scaling-service owner first; if no ack in 15 minutes, escalate to platform security. Findings from review should be reported through the usual channel, and triage questions go here.

billing contact of tahaf-kafop = istwyn_fraox@norvaworks.corp

MEMO — Kettling Depot Receiving

Uniform sets for the new Kettling depot arrive Wednesday via Ashgrove courier: 40 boxes, sorted by size, manifest attached to box one. Check the count at the dock before signing; shortages go straight to stores, not the courier. The hand-over instruction the courier will follow is set out below.

drop instructions, tafof-baguf: the holmir gilox courier leaves the sormir ulaok holdor ledger at gate 5596 under passcode 257343

Action item from the Mirewater tide-table widget incident. Owner: release manager. Widget cached stale harbor offsets after the DST change, showing tides six hours off for two days. Required: add a cache-invalidation check to the release checklist, block deploys when offset tables are older than 24 hours, and verify the Saltgate harbor feed before each cut. Deadline: next release. Checklist template and sign-off procedure are documented on the internal page below.

wiki page, kawif-bajep: https://artifactory.zarqelforge.internal/issue/browse/display/display/projects/spaces/secrets/000fe6ec5a46af29355003e1